Yemen sends thousands of troops to fight Qaeda
[Al Arabiya Latest] Yemen has sent thousands of security forces to take part in a campaign against al-Qaeda in three provinces, and authorities have detained five suspected fighters from the group, a security source said on Tuesday. "The campaign is continuing in the capital and in the provinces of Shabwa and Maarib," the source told Reuters, speaking on customary condition of anonymity. The manhunt is also going on in the southern province of Abyan.

Meanwhile, the United States embassy in Yemen reopened on Tuesday, an embassy official said, a day after Yemeni forces killed two al-Qaeda militants they said were behind a threat that had forced U.S. and European missions to close.

"We are reopened," a U.S. embassy official said. The embassy had closed on Sunday in response to what it said were al-Qaeda threats and came as concern grew about stability in the poorest Arab country.

The British and French embassies resumed operations but remained closed to the public, diplomats at those embassies said.
